How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 52808?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 52808 Studio Apartments | $930 | $500 | $1,375 |
| 52808 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,084 | $615 | $1,900 |
| 52808 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,296 | $700 | $3,250 |
| 52808 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,638 | $815 | $3,300 |
| 52808 4 Bedroom Apartments | $967 | $930 | $1,005 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 52808 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 52808?
There are currently 49 Studio Apartments in 52808 with rent ranges from $580 to $1,375 with an average price of $930.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 52808 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 52808 ranges from $615 to $1,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,084.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 52808 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 52808 range from $700 to $3,250.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,296.
How expensive are 52808 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 37 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 52808 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$815 to $3,300 - averaging $1,638 for the location.
